Dried shiitake mushrooms are used in Chinese cooking and other Asian cuisines to add an intense umami flavor and fragrance to soups, stews, stir-fries, braised dishes, and more. The soaking liquid can also be used to add a rich mushroom flavor to soups and sauces.
Cover the mushrooms in boiling water ; soak for 20 minutes. ...
The mushrooms should almost double in size. Drain. ...
Discard the stems €“ they're too tough to eat. Slice the mushrooms and add to stir-fries, soups and curries.
